If the insulation is damp, do not cover it until the resource of dampness is gotten rid of and the insulation is completely dry. If the insulation is completely dry, it will possibly be all right to leave it in area.
Examine the deepness of the insulation to establish its shielding worth. Compare this with the recommended insulation values partly 2.2, Control of heat flow. See to it that the insulation is distributed evenly which there is full deepness coverage, specifically around the perimeter of the attic over the wall surface plates.

Residences need to have a vapour obstacle on the cozy side of the insulation. In older homes, the vapour barrier may have been provided by wax paper, kraft paper-backed batts or layers of paint. Newer residences usually have a polyethylene sheet vapour barrier, yet on the whole, very few homes have a reliable air obstacle.
